Abstract
The Greek crisis has raised many concerns about its potential effects on the fragile post-communist Albanian economy. This report analyzes the effects of the crisis, taking into account 1) structural issues related to the model of post-communist economic development and 2) conjectural challenges to crucial sectors that constitute the bilateral relations between Greece and Albania. The analysis suggests that the potential sectoral and ad hoc consequences of the crisis could prove dangerous when combined with the overall structural weakness of the economy, which suffers from increasing current balance and budgetary deficits as well as a model of development that relies largely on external sources of revenue.
